However, provided you choose to ... WebCurrently there are over 40 medical schools that offer graduate entry medicine . You can only select 4 on the UCAS application Each has a different requirement in terms of degree & A level/IB subjects that are required All medical schools will require you to sit one of the following aptitude tests as part of your application; GAMSAT, UCAT or BMAT. WebSep 1, 2024 · The majority of graduate entry programmes require students to have their first degree in a science subject, but some medical schools also consider applicants with a first degree in an arts subjects.
